Much easier to navigate with recent redesign and added signage. Can be slick or underwater when wet. Dual concrete tees on every hole. 8th hole pro tee shoots over a mucky pond. Discs at Ice Arena office ($1 + $10 deposit). Foliage is thick in summer; rough can cut you. After an open hole on #1, most everything else is in fairly dense woods. A quick and dirty nine for the time-conscious.

Location

Founders Sports Park 35500 Eight Mile Rd. Farmington Hills, 48335 Michigan
Local Directions:

I-275; exit 168 (8 Mile Rd.). Go east 2 miles to park entrance on the left at the light. It is between Farmington and Halsted/Newburgh. First tee is between 8 mile road and the skate park.
